AI辨别不同棋型的代码实现

  

学习提示:如果没有C语言与Windows项目开发基础可以通过下方链接学习:

0基础C语言学习与训练

0基础C++学习与训练

Windows项目开发系列

 

在前一章的基础上,我们继续学习如何通过代码,实现AI辨别不同棋型的功能,那么,在五子棋的游戏中,每颗棋子

都可以有8个方向的组合,而每个方向也可以出现不同的组合情况,所以,AI必须有方法辨别不同方向中的威胁组合

情况,那么,我们需要完成以下的内容。

(1)区分连续与不连续的棋型威胁进行处理。

(2)设置连续棋型的分值。

(3)设置不连续棋型的分值。

(4)保存不同棋型的分值。

(5)保存不同棋型的棋子数量。

以上的内容我们将结合代码为大家作详细的讲解,大家可以通过下面的链接进行学习。

点击链接学习